libmysqlcppconn-dev Sample

来源:互联网 发布:非法软件下载 编辑:程序博客网 时间:2024/06/06 21:40


#include <stdlib.h>
#include <iostream>
#include <mysql_connection.h>
#include <driver.h>
#include <exception.h>
#include <resultset.h>
#include <statement.h>


using namespace sql;
int main(void){
  sql::Driver *driver;
  sql::Connection *con;
  Statement *state;
  sql::ResultSet *result;
//  std::time_t timeresult=std::time(nullptr);
  driver = get_driver_instance();
  con = driver->connect("tcp://192.168.0.110:3306","root","123maiqi");
  state =con->createStatement();
  std::cout <<"connection sucessful!" <<std::endl;
  state->execute("use maiqi_model");


 // std::cout <<std::asctime(std::localtime(&timeresult)) <<std::endl;
  result= state->executeQuery("select * from model");


  std::cout <<result <<std::endl;
  // std::cout <<std::asctime(std::localtime(&timeresult)) <<std::endl;
  return 0;
}


g++ -Wall -I/usr/include/cppconn -o testapp tester.cpp -L/usr/lib -lmysqlcppconn

0 0